How does BrokerList in Kafka Sink work ?

avatar

Customer's Flume Kafka Sink,

we have defined agent.sinks.kafka-netflow-ci.brokerList=edge01:9092,edge02:9092,edge03:9092

Question is How does sink uses the broker list ?

Are edge02 and edge03 used in case edge01 is failing or will they be used randomly ?

from the internet i could below , But still not clear on this.

The brokers in the Kafka sink uses to discover topic partitions, formatted as a comma-separated list of hostname:port entries. You do not need to specify the entire list of brokers, but Cloudera recommends that you specify at least two for high availability.

1 ACCEPTED SOLUTION

avatar

broker.list for kafka consumers or producers used for bootstrapping. Consumer or Producer makes a request to get TopicMetadata which tells the clients what are the topic partitions and who are leaders for these partitions so that clients can send requests to the leaders.

To answer your question brokerList will be shuffled and it will go through each one of the hosts and makes TopicMetadataRequest if its succeeded it will return , if not it will continue to next broker.

avatar

@schintalapani@hortonworks.com . Thanks. Just wanted to clarify the leader of the partition is only valid when we have replication in place ?. If we dont have any replication (replication factor 1) . It just need to look for the topic with partitions list and would connect to the each partition based on the partition key.?

avatar

Even if there is no replication there will be a leader. It still makes a call to broker.list to find out who is the leader for given topic-partition. Partitions are spread across the cluster so the client still needs who is leader of a partition irrespective of replication.

avatar

The partitions will be distributed among the kafka nodes. If you created a topic with 3 partitions and you've 3 kafka nodes than each node will get a single topic partition and it will be the leader for it. When there is no Key in the messages you are trying to write , Kafka client does a round robin picking of each node and writes to that topic partition and moves on to next one.

If you provide a key it will do hash based partitioning to determine which topic partition to write to.
